    When I bought this car, it had the original title with it and on the title it said the previous owner of the car was MARY KAY HOPKINS. One of the guys on here told me that the MARY KAY Package wasn't started until 68 I think? But still pretty neat. Although I'm not an old lady, I still love this car. And again, you ask why but I ask why not? THe passenger side door hardly opens and I couldn't see spending weeks searching for new hinges when I could make some work that I already had. Just so opens they make the door open backwards haha :D It's something in my blood that makes me fix what 60's auto stylists messed up. Clearly, that being the doors :p

    I am working on sound deadening the interior, fiberglassing the door panels and I am considering body dropping it 2" so it lays rocker. I still need to finish the doors and I want to pull the motor so I can smooth the firewall and reseal/gaskette the motor. Everything is still kinda up in the air. I am going to drive the car this summer in primer so I can decide if this is how I want the body before I paint it. Oh yah, I am re-doing the suspension and adding air to the front ( was just air in the rear and cut coils up front ).
